William L. Weaver

William L. Weaver (son of Jarrett Weaver and Elizabeth Jones) was born on February 10, 1822 in Butts County, Georgia. He died on August 19, 1894.  He married Emily L. Andrews on October 19, 1845 in Butts County, Georgia. She was born in 1828 in Pike County, Georgia.

William L. Weaver is buried at Weaver Cemetery in Guntersville, Marshall, Alabama.  

Children of William L. Weaver and Emily L. Andrews
1. Mary Jane Weaver was born  on November 29, 1846.
2. John Fleming Huddleston Weaver was born in 1848.
3. Emily B. Weaver was born in 1851 in Georgia.
4. Willis J. Weaver was born on July 16, 1855.
5. Lorenzo Dow Weaver was born on September 20, 1857 in Jackson, Butts, Georgia. He died on November 29, 1922 in Guntersville, Marshall, Alabama.  He was buried in Weaver Cemetery in Guntersville, Marshall, Alabama
6. Ida S. Weaver was born on July 22, 1859.
7. Ivy Weaver was born in 1862 in Georgia.
8. Lillie Ocie Weaver was born on April 27, 1864.
9. Anna Lee Weaver was born on March 13, 1867.

Obituary of Rev. William L. Weaver - Middle Ga. Argus – Week of September 6, 1894
Rev. Wm. L. Weaver, formerly a citizen of our county, who has for several years been a resident of Marshall County, Alabama, died last week. His son, Mr. Willie Weaver, of our county, was notified of his father’s serious illness some few days ago, and was with the old gentleman when he died. Many of our older citizens were his personal friends and will be sorry to learn of his sad death.
